Which stage of prenatal development is the most critical?

The embryonic period is the most critical period of development because of the formation of internal and external structures.

Why is the embryonic stage critical in prenatal development?

The embryonic stage plays an important role in the development of the brain. Approximately four weeks after conception, the neural tube forms. This tube will later develop into the central nervous system including the spinal cord and brain. The neural tube begins to form along with an area known as the neural plate.

During which period of prenatal development is the baby most vulnerable to damage if exposed to harmful substances?

The fetus is most vulnerable during the first 12 weeks. During this period of time, all of the major organs and body systems are forming and can be damaged if the fetus is exposed to drugs, infectious agents, radiation, certain medications, tobacco and toxic substances.

Is Mango good for pregnancy?

Not only are mangos safe to eat while you’re pregnant, but they contain a host of nutrients that are beneficial to you. One ¾ cup serving of mango is a good source of folate, which is a key pre-natal vitamin. Women who don’t get enough folate are at risk of having babies with neural tube defects, such as spina bifida.

Is there anything you Cannot eat while pregnant?

The bottom line When you’re pregnant, it’s essential to avoid foods and beverages that may put you and your baby at risk. Although most foods and beverages are perfectly safe to enjoy, some, like raw fish, unpasteurized dairy, alcohol, and high mercury fish, should be avoided.
